By June 2026, TikTok Shop’s total visits across six Southeast Asian markets reached 438.9 million — 85.9% of Shopee’s traffic and approximately 6.1 times Lazada’s. The platform has gone from disruptor to incumbent in under three years. But traffic isn’t the whole story. Each platform serves a different purpose in a brand’s social commerce strategy, and the smartest brands aren’t choosing one — they’re building platform-specific playbooks.
TikTok Shop: The Growth Engine
TikTok Shop’s GMV in Southeast Asia doubled year-over-year to US$45.6 billion in 2025, driven by its content-first discovery model. Short videos, live streams, and affiliate creators form an integrated funnel where entertainment leads to purchase without app-switching. The platform captures 45% of Indonesia’s social commerce market and has nearly closed the traffic gap with Shopee in Vietnam (3.4% difference) and Indonesia (0.4% difference). Best for: beauty, fashion, FMCG targeting 18–35 demographic. Requires: consistent content production and creator partnerships — this is not a “list and wait” platform.
Shopee Live: The Conversion Machine
Shopee remains the GMV leader at US$832 billion across the region, and Shopee Live drives over 60% of its social commerce sales with conversion rates of 5.8–7.2%. Its strength is the integrated checkout experience — viewers transition to purchase without leaving the stream. Shopee Live excels at deal-driven, mass-market categories: consumer goods, electronics, everyday essentials. The platform’s voucher and flash sale mechanics create urgency that TikTok’s entertainment-first model doesn’t replicate. Best for: conversion-heavy campaigns, price-sensitive consumers, broad-reach categories.
LazLive: The Brand Builder
Lazada’s live commerce ecosystem caters to a more affluent, brand-conscious audience. With strong LazMall integration, high production value capabilities, and robust backend analytics, LazLive is the platform of choice for established brands in electronics, lifestyle, and premium categories. Its audience is smaller than TikTok or Shopee, but higher-intent. Best for: brand storytelling, premium product launches, categories where trust and brand equity drive purchase decisions.
Instagram & Facebook Live: The Community Channel
Meta’s platforms retain relevance, particularly in markets like Thailand (Facebook: 55% social commerce share) and among small businesses building community-first commerce. Instagram Shopping has grown to 12% of Indonesia’s social commerce market. These platforms work best as brand-owned engagement channels — less about impulse purchase, more about nurturing existing audiences. Best for: local businesses, community-driven brands, remarketing to existing followers.
The Platform Portfolio Approach
The winning strategy for most brands is a portfolio: TikTok Shop for discovery and growth, Shopee Live for conversion volume, LazLive for brand equity, and Meta for community retention. The brands trying to win on just one platform are leaving money — and audience segments — on the table.
